Study both business and computer and information sciences, and prepare yourself for a wide range of careers in as little as four years. A sound understanding of computer and information sciences is essential for any business. With the Bachelor of Business and Bachelor of Computer and Information Sciences conjoint programmes you develop a sound technical understanding of computing and information technology and knowledge of core business disciplines. You gain the ability to plan, develop and apply appropriate technologies and tools to framing and solving problems in a range of contexts. A list of majors in the programme is available.

To be eligible for admission, domestic students need University Entrance, while international applicants need to have completed Year 13 Cambridge International Examinations or the International Baccalaureate (or equivalent). Degree-specific requirements are listed on the website.


Domestic student fees
are approximately NZ$6700 per year, while international students are charged approximately US$21,000 per year. Scholarships and awards are available at this study level for all students, such as the Dream NEW Scholarship and the Keir Trust Study Award. Explore your funding options here.

To be eligible for postgraduate study at Auckland University of Technology, you need a relevant bachelor’s degree and, if coming from a non-English speaking country, proof of your proficiency in English. Explore entry requirements in more detail here.

Tuition fees for domestic students at the postgraduate level are NZ$8,711 (with some exceptions),  while international students are charged between US$4,941 (for PhD study) and US$38,120, depending on the course.
